Transaction 20bceb012d6d83da81e19ada412445838ef8c8f6c6d5e89a24bb6163faabff68
1 Input
2 Outputs
- 20bceb012d6d83da81e19ada412445838ef8c8f6c6d5e89a24bb6163faabff68:0
- 20bceb012d6d83da81e19ada412445838ef8c8f6c6d5e89a24bb6163faabff68:1
value 18359000
address 1KTfepNUhrtrSqC3gkfEDkK6Ym39Dk2t4s
value 153946048
address 1PPCEFbc2QNSLpSfc12ksosJifE6W78Dht